I have seen remarks about the Accel injectors' spray
pattern not being ideal for our cars. Dunno whether it
is true or not, or across all Accel types.

Matching is peace of mind and consistency. Which
may, or not, buy you anything depending on the box
of as-manufactured ones you would've bought. The
next random box could be grouped as tight or tighter
than flow matching guarantees its window, or could
have one squirrel that drives you nuts chasing knock
retard.

If I were paying the retail price I think I'd pony up
the extra green. But I bought used ones and will just
check them myself for "close enough".

I had that squirrel in a set of Racetronix... no KR but different LTFT B1 / B2.
Then I went with a set of flow matched Bosch: now I have maybe 1% diffeence (it was like 10% difference at low load before and 5% at high load).
